The overview below groups typical Concrete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Burnsville, MN.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Repair Costs - The typical cost for concrete repair services ranges from $500 to $2,500, depending on the extent of damage. For minor cracks or surface repairs, costs often stay closer to the lower end of this range. Larger or more complex repairs can push costs toward the higher end.
Material and Labor Fees - Material costs for concrete repair materials generally fall between $3 and $10 per square foot, with labor charges adding to the overall expense. For example, patching a small driveway might cost around $1,000, including materials and labor.
Project Size Impact - Small-scale repairs, such as fixing cracks in a patio, typically cost between $300 and $1,000. Larger projects, like resurfacing an entire driveway, can range from $2,000 to $5,000 or more, depending on size and complexity.
Additional Expenses - Factors like surface preparation, removal of old concrete, or reinforcement can increase costs by several hundred dollars. Contact local pros for detailed estimates tailored to specific repair needs and project scope.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What types of concrete repair services are available? Local service providers offer a range of repairs including crack filling, surface leveling, patching, and structural reinforcement to address various issues with concrete surfaces.
How do I know if my concrete needs repair? Signs such as cracking, spalling, uneven surfaces, or visible deterioration can indicate that concrete repair services are needed.
Are concrete repairs suitable for both residential and commercial properties? Yes, local pros provide concrete repair services for residential driveways, patios, and walkways, as well as commercial floors, foundations, and other structures.
What materials are used in concrete repair? Repair specialists typically use materials like epoxy, polymer overlays, patching compounds, and sealants to restore and strengthen concrete surfaces.
How long does concrete repair typically take? The duration varies depending on the extent of damage and the specific repair needed; a local contractor can provide an estimate based on the project scope.
